Final Details of the Launch and Separation 

  • Liftoff occurred in Baikonur on Friday, March 15, 5:18 a.m. local time (Thursday, March 14, 7:18 p.m EDT,  23:18 Thursday GMT)  

  • The  Breeze M upper stage suffered an anomaly and shut down during its second burn. The satellite was released into an orbit of approximately 26,000 km by 770 km at 49 degrees inclination.
